biography of George SPANGENBERG (1907-1964)

Birth place: Buffalo, NY

Addresses: Buffalo, NY; Southern California, 1930s

Profession: Landscape painter

Studied: Charles Burchfield; John Carlson; Buffalo Sch. FA

Member: Niagara Art Guild

Comments: Specialty: portraits and still lifes, landscape around San Diego. It is said that he often traded his works for food and art supplies. In 1964 a fire destroyed his studio and most of his work perished, except for that done in Calif.

Sources: Hughes, Artists in California, 527.
